> > > On 1/5/2025 7:07 PM, Dmitry Baryshkov wrote:
> > > > Move perf mode handling for the bandwidth to
> > > > _dpu_core_perf_crtc_update_bus() rather than overriding per-CRTC data
> > > > and then aggregating known values.
> > > > 
> > > > Note, this changes the fix_core_ab_vote. Previously it would be
> > > > multiplied per the CRTC number, now it will be used directly for
> > > > interconnect voting. This better reflects user requirements in the case
> > > > of different resolutions being set on different CRTCs: instead of using
> > > > the same bandwidth for each CRTC (which is incorrect) user can now
> > > > calculate overall bandwidth required by all outputs and use that value.
> > > > 
> > > 
> > > There are two things this change is doing:
> > > 
> > > 1) Dropping the core_clk_rate setting because its already handled inside
> > > _dpu_core_perf_get_core_clk_rate() and hence dpu_core_perf_crtc_update()
> > > will still work.
> > > 
> > > and
> > > 
> > > 2) Then this part of moving the ab/ib setting to
> > > _dpu_core_perf_crtc_update_bus().
> > > 
> > > Can we split this into two changes so that its clear that dropping
> > > core_clk_rate setting in this change will not cause an issue.
> > 
> > Ack
> > 
> 
> Actually I think this is incorrect.
> 
> If the user puts in an incorrect value beyond the bounds, earlier the code
> will reject that by failing the in _dpu_core_perf_calc_crtc().

This function doesn't perform any validation nor returns an error code.
Probably you've meant some other function.

> 
> Now, if we move it to _dpu_core_perf_crtc_update_bus(), this is beyond the
> check phase so incorrect values cannot be rejected.
> 
> So we will still need to preserve overriding the values in
> _dpu_core_perf_calc_crtc().
